How does Knights Bridge Company Limited use cookies or other tracking technologies?

Knights Bridge Company Limited uses cookies on this website. Cookies are small text files sent to and stored on users’ computers that allow websites to recognize repeat users, facilitate users’ access to websites and allow websites to compile aggregate data that will allow content improvements. Cookies do not damage users’ computers or files. If you do not want cookies to be accessible by this or any other Knights Bridge Company Limited website, you should adjust the settings on your browser program to deny or disable the use of cookies. The cookies that Knights Bridge Company Limited uses on this site do not identify you. The cookies simply provide Knights Bridge Company Limited with aggregate, anonymous analytics about the number of people visiting particular pages on this website.

This website may also use web beacons. A web beacon is usually a pixel on a website that can be used to track whether a user has visited a particular website to deliver targeted advertising. Web beacons are used in combination with cookies, which means that, if you turn off your browser’s cookies, the web beacons will not be able to track your activity. The web beacon will still account for a website visit, but your unique information will not be recorded.
